    I live in South Florida so I’ve painted my share of palms. I use a couple sizes of filbert brushes for the fronds. I hold the brush perpendicular to the paper. They hold a lot of paint so you don’t run out halfway through the frond. By rotating the brush as you go you can get some nice variation of the leaves.
